0

我们如何使用提琴手来检查两个网站之间的网络服务(xml)的流量?
http://www.fiddler2.com/fiddler2/

我为我的网站创建了两个子域。
例如我的网站是这样的:

www.site.com

这些子域如下所示:

www.sub1.site.com

www.sub2.site.com

这些站点位于 Web 服务器 (vps) 上,我正在使用本地系统观看它们(我的本地系统上已安装 fiddler)。
www.sub1.site.com 正在调用 www.sub2.site.com 网络服务。
是否可以使用 http 等断点捕获此 Web 服务数据?
我检查了很多次提琴手,但找不到如何?
如果不是 Fiddler 中的 XML 选项卡是什么?

非常感谢您的回答和帮助

4

1 回答 1

5

您不能为此使用 Fiddler2。Fiddler2 是一个 Web 代理,它通过在您自己的机器上运行的代理来路由您的浏览器请求。所以它只有在发出 HTTP 请求的“客户端”是本地的时才有效。例如,您的浏览器可能会向 www.sub1.site.com 发起 HTTP 请求,但从 www.sub1.site.com 到 www.sub2.site.com 的调用不会通过 Fiddler2 进行路由。将 Fiddler2 想象成位于您的浏览器和浏览器试图访问的任何站点之间。

如果您有权在服务器 (sub1) 上安装 Fiddler2,对于一些更复杂的场景,您可能会考虑使用http://www.fiddler2.com/fiddler/help/reverseproxy.asp 。但是,如果您可以访问服务器,还有其他监控方法可能是更好的选择(例如日志文件)。

于 2012-05-07T21:03:09.893 回答